What are some trends in stone textures?
Current trends in stone textures include incorporating textures that mimic natural formations, such as geodes or agate, using contrasting textures to create visual interest, and using textures in unexpected ways, such as incorporating them into typography or animation.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when using stone textures in design?
Common mistakes to avoid when using stone textures in design include using low-quality textures, using too many textures in one design, and using textures that clash with the overall design style or color scheme.
How can I edit or customize stone textures to fit my design project?
You can edit and customize stone textures using design software such as Adobe Photoshop or Illustrator. Some potential edits include adjusting the hue and saturation, adding filters or effects, or cropping the texture to fit specific design elements.

What types of stone textures are available for use in design?
There are many types of stone textures available for use in design, including marble, granite, sandstone, limestone, slate, and many others.
What are some benefits of using stone textures in design?
Using stone textures in design can add a sense of luxury, sophistication, and stability to a design project. It can also convey a sense of natural beauty and durability.
What are some common applications of stone textures?
Common applications of stone textures include creating website backgrounds, designing brochures, flyers, or other marketing materials for businesses, and creating realistic 3D visualizations of interior design projects.
What is stone textures design?
Stone textures design is a type of design that incorporates realistic textures of various types of stone, such as marble, granite, or slate, into graphic design, web design, or interior design projects.
